### Summary Sign-in response timing differed between known and unknown email addresses because the unknown-user branch returned without performing a password hash comparison. ### Details The unknown-user branch in `auth.service.ts` now performs a `bcrypt.compare` against a fixed dummy hash so the response time of failed sign-ins is approximately independent of whether the address exists. Rate limiting on the sign-in endpoint is implemented in the Enterprise build only and is not affected by this advisory. ### Impact A network-positioned attacker could enumerate registered email addresses by timing sign-in responses. Exploitation requires only the ability to send unauthenticated sign-in requests. ### Credit This issue was reported by [@AndyAnh174](https://github.com/AndyAnh174).
Update nocodb to 2026.04.1 if you use the affected versions. Test the change in a non-production environment first.

AI coding agents often install or upgrade packages automatically in npm. A medium vulnerability in a dependency can be pulled into a project through a normal install or update without a human reviewing the change, expanding the blast radius from a single package to every agent workspace that depends on it.
